[22]An elderly woman yesterday made a legal claim against a department store because it had wrongly accused her of [23]stealing a Christmas card. Mrs. Doss White, 72 years old, is claiming $3,000 damages from the store for wrongful arrest and false imprisonment.
Mrs. White visited the store while doing Christmas shopping, but did not buy anything. She was followed through the town by a store manager. He had been told that a customer saw her take a card and put it in her shopping bag. He stopped her at a bookstore as she was reading a book. Mrs. White said, "This man, a total stranger, suddenly grasped my bag and asked if he could look in it." [24]She was taken back to the store and shut in a small room in full view of shoppers for 20 minutes until the police arrived. At the police station she was body-searched and nothing was found. [25]Her lawyer said that the department store sent an insincere apology and they insisted that she may have been stealing. The hearing continues today.
